Background technique
Swamp eel is one of the important aquatic products of domestic and international market consumption, and supply exceed demand, but seed becomes restriction swamp eel production The bottleneck problem of industry.Currently, fish wild seed is unable to satisfy the demand of culture of swamp eel, it is necessary to solve the problems, such as artificial seed.Swamp eel with Other fish have a very big difference, i.e. sexual reversal phenomenon.In nature, swamp eel is entirely raun at the initial stage of life, must It must be after breeding at least once, raun can just be converted to milter.In the swamp eel propagated artificially at present, as long as the fingerling launched Specification is in 15 tails/jin hereinafter, then almost all is raun.It is bred to the large-scale artificial of swamp eel, must just carry out swamp eel Parent population is specially cultivated.
Swamp eel is born to being entirely female in 1 year, and 2 ages and 2 more than age are gradually changed into male, some even need 6-8 Nian Caineng is changed into male.Therefore, male is big, does not match that with female, high production cost, becomes and restricts its artificial seed One of key factor of breeding.In monopterus albus fry breeding production, urgent need solves the problems, such as swamp eel male parent.
Summary of the invention
The present invention provides the cultivating and managing methods of male swamp eel parent a kind of, promote the sex reversal of swamp eel parent, batch The consistent male swamp eel parent of growth specification is obtained, solves the problems, such as male parent in swamp eel reproductive process.
In order to achieve the above objectives,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
A kind of cultivating and managing method of male swamp eel parent, comprising the following specific steps
(1) training orientation of postpartum female eel:
After having spent swamp eel breeding period, swamp eel after oviposition is caught out, and select individual weight in the female eel of 60-80g in month current year 7-9 It launches in pond net box, the stocking rate of each net cage is 3.5-4kg/m2, and be sieved with sub-sieve device, accomplish that eel kind is advised in same case Lattice is originally consistent, and after feeding 10-15 days in female eel investment net cage, is carried out 5-6 weeks Nature enemy, is during which carried out to net cage Continuous 1 week shading dark processing is accelerated postpartum female eel and is changed to male;
(2) overwintering preceding culture:
Later to swamp eel refeeding after starvation, timing daily, fixed point feed bait, and feed is using fresh animal bait and cooperation Feed is mixed according to the ratio of 3-5:1, and the mixed feed is existed using swelling soya dreg, rice bran, white fish meal composition, protein content 30-35% is cultivated to November current year, is stopped feeding, swamp eel enters Wintering Period, and the overwintering in pond net box;
(3) spring in next year cultivates:
After overwintering, when April in next year, water temperature rose to 16 DEG C or more, start to be fed, the spermary of swamp eel starts to send out at this time It educates, starts in feed 1 week, feed the bait such as fresh earthworm, screw meat according to the 0.8-1.5% of swamp eel weight, start to add later Enter swamp eel special compound feed, the amount of addition sequentially progressive method gradually increases daily, be gradually increased to mixed feed with The ratio of fresh and alive feed is in 1:(1.5-2) standard, feed culture to 5-6 month, swamp eel testis development is mature, can be transferred to numerous It grows in pond.
Wherein, feeding volume is the 2.5-4% of swamp eel weight after step (2) refeeding, according to the intensity of feeding, remains material Situations such as adjust feeding amount in time, Feeding time is controlled in daily 8:00-9:00,18:00-19:00.
Wherein, swamp eel special compound feed main component includes swelling soya dreg, rice bran, white fish meal, answers in the step (3) Close vitamin, composite mineral matter, protein content 38%-40%.
Wherein, water peanut is planted in the net cage, cultivated area accounts for the 50-60% of net cage area.
The present invention has the beneficial effect that:
Nature enemy is carried out to the female eel after oviposition in the present invention, prolonged nutritional deficiency can lead to the degeneration of ovary, simultaneously With the appearance of male characteristic, dark processing is carried out during Nature enemy, effectively facilitates melatonin in night Monopterus Albus Secretion, reduce Finless Eel Monopterus Albus in melatonin level diurnal fluctuation, to promote the sex reversal of swamp eel, so that in swamp eel group Sex reversal growth is consistent, and protein content in feed is controlled in overwintering preceding cultivating process, turns being basically completed property of swamp eel Become, then after spring in next year cultivates, swamp eel parent's male ratio reaches 95% or more, the growth consistent male of specification can be obtained in batches Swamp eel parent.
